Rae Thoma Rae Fetsa is the nickname of the Orlando Pirates and Bafana Bafana player, Relebohile Mofokeng, also known as President yama 2000. The name means "We start it, we finish it" in SeSotho.
Example

Rae Thoma Rae Fetsa, Rae Thoma Rae Fetsa. Wa nyisa boy.

Die poppie sal dans is a popular South African term that means there will be trouble or havoc.
The direct translation from Afrikaans is: The dolls will dance
Example

Mom told them to take out the meat from the freezer in the morning and they forgot. Die poppie sal dans when she comes back from church.

Dankie is an Afrikaans term for "thank you". It is however used informally in almost all the South African languages for showing gratitude.
Example

Man 1: You left your phone in the bathroom, I left it at the reception.
Man 2: Dankie, chief.
